The revised AIFM agreement maintains the existing 12-month termination notice period. In the event of termination, the AIFM will remain entitled, for the full duration of the notice period, to receive a fee calculated solely on the basis of NAV. This notice period provision remains unchanged.
"The Board remains resolutely focused on acting in the best interests of ORIT's shareholders and we are pleased to have agreed the revised fee arrangement with the investment manager. This reflects our recognition of the broader challenges facing listed renewables infrastructure companies alongside our commitment to improving cost efficiency and enhancing shareholder value.
"We believe this step better aligns the investment manager's interests with those of shareholders, with a clear focus on enhancing the Company's share price performance. We look forward to updating shareholders on our interim results, alongside operations and strategic direction, at our capital markets event on Tuesday 23 September."
